Question 1: Under Wyoming law, which entity can access your driving record without your permission?
- Your employer's HR department
- A private investigator
- Insurance companies under DPPA permissible use (Correct answer)
- A neighbor disputing a traffic incident
Correct answer: Insurance companies under DPPA permissible use
The federal Driver's Privacy Protection Act (DPPA) allows insurance companies to access driving records for underwriting purposes without driver consent.

Question 3: A Wyoming title 'lien release' document indicates:
- The vehicle failed a safety inspection
- A lienholder no longer has a financial claim on the vehicle (Correct answer)
- The vehicle was involved in a major accident
- The owner has unpaid registration fees
Correct answer: A lienholder no longer has a financial claim on the vehicle
A lien release shows that a lender or lienholder has been paid in full and no longer holds an interest in the vehicle.
Question 4: Which of the following is a valid reason an employer may request an employee's Wyoming driving record?
- To determine the employee's credit score
- To verify the employee's driving qualifications for a job requiring driving (Correct answer)
- To check the employee's criminal history
- To confirm the employee's home address
Correct answer: To verify the employee's driving qualifications for a job requiring driving
Employers may request driving records under DPPA permissible use when driving is part of the job.

Question 7: In Wyoming, who is authorized to request a third-party's driving record for litigation purposes?
- Any member of the public
- Only law enforcement
- A licensed attorney representing a party in a lawsuit (Correct answer)
- A financial institution
Correct answer: A licensed attorney representing a party in a lawsuit
DPPA allows licensed attorneys to access driving records when needed for use in litigation.
